AI Is Already in Use Across Your Organisation. Is It Governed?

Most organisations now have AI in active use across their teams, often spreading faster than policy, security testing, and monitoring can keep pace with. With many employees already using AI tools at work and many organisations still operating without a formal AI policy, the gap between adoption and governance is where the real exposure sits.

Three challenges tend to arrive together. Organisations need clear governance and policy to meet tightening regulation such as the EU AI Act and ISO 42001. The AI systems themselves, including chatbots, copilots, and agentic workflows, introduce a new category of vulnerability that calls for dedicated security testing. And shadow AI spreading across departments leaves teams without visibility into where AI is being used and what data is flowing into it.

In this session, DigitalXRAID's consultancy, testing, and SOC engineering leads walk through all three: building a defensible AI policy aligned to ISO 42001, testing AI and LLM systems against threats like prompt injection and excessive agency, and detecting shadow AI to monitor activity across your environment. It is built for organisations securing their own AI use and for partners building AI security into their offering.
